Recreation Areas at Lake Hartwell to be Open During Hunting Season

Four recreation areas at Lake Hartwell will be open for archery and small game hunting during the 2017-18 hunting season.

These areas include Paynes Creek Park, Hartwell Dam Quarry Area, New Prospect Park and Jenkins Ferry Park.

Small game hunting is allowed in all areas listed above, but only after the deer and turkey seasons close. Hunting for small game is restricted to shotgun only with number 4 shot or smaller.

However, the Hartwell Dam Quarry is restricted to archery equipment only during deer and turkey seasons. A permit is required which is available at no cost from the Corps’ Hartwell Lake Office.

Hunting for deer and turkey is restricted to archery equipment only – all firearms are prohibited. The areas will be open on a walk-in or boat-in only basis. No motorized vehicles will be allowed within the gated area. Only portable stands and blinds are acceptable and must be removed from public land after the season.

Hunting is prohibited in all designated recreation areas except those listed above. All other public lands and waters around Hartwell Lake, including islands, are open to hunting in accordance with Title 36 Code of Federal Regulations and Georgia and South Carolina hunting regulations. Due to safety concerns, big game hunters are encouraged to use archery equipment only while hunting on the islands.
